Cheap Laminate Flooring is an Inexpensive Home Improvement Option

Cheap Laminate Flooring is an Inexpensive Home Improvement Option

Sarah Louise BrownNovember 14, 2025April 29, 2023

In today’s world it is hard to trust the word “cheap,” it has become synonymous with shoddy, low quality products. Cheap laminate flooring is one product that continues to have a low price tag, but an excellent value for a lasting, durable product. Laminate has become more popular since 1996, some companies even boasts that it is the ‘most popular’ flooring sold today.

A variety of companies including Mohawk Laminates, Armstrong Laminates, Alloc Laminates, Berry Laminates, and Wilsonart Laminates make a wide range of patterns and styles of laminate flooring to meet customers needs. These companies are not the only companies, there are many companies worldwide that specialize in different types of laminates.

Laminate flooring is resilient, low maintenance, and inexpensive. I was amazed to see prices start at $2.49 per square foot. The variety of wood and earth simulating patterns and the variety of colors available are amazing, there is even flooring that has been enhanced with texture to give it more of a real wood or stone appearance and feel.

Cheap laminate flooring is easy to install, which attracts many people who prefer to do their own home improvement projects rather than paying for professionals to install their flooring. It can be water repellant and can be used in wet areas, and is popular for indoor and outdoor flooring. It is an attractive option for outdoor projects, less expensive than wood or stone, and easier to install and care for. Few other inexpensive flooring options are made for outdoor settings.

There are other types of flooring which are also low maintenance and inexpensive such as sheet vinyl flooring or vinyl tiles and planks; each has its advantages. Laminate flooring can be easier to install as it does not come in a large roll like sheet vinyl does. Laminate comes in planks that are either fitted together like puzzle pieces or are glued together as they are fitted. Laminate flooring provides the beauty of a hardwood floor without the high maintenance that normally goes with hardwood floors, and its price tag is more attractive as well.

It is important when purchasing your laminate flooring to consider what your needs are for the area you plan to use it in, does it need to be water resistant or repellent; does it have a high quality coating to minimize potential damage from high traffic or scratches? Price should not be the only consideration in your choice.

When laminate flooring was first developed, the coating protecting the tiles wore through easily and the tiles were easy to damage or discolor. Over the years, laminate companies have changed what materials they use to increase the durability and beauty of their flooring to make it competitive with other flooring types, without its old disadvantages. Adding a sublayer of flooring below the laminate can add to comfort and decrease sound, as well as enhancing the floor’s longevity.
